Description of Activity:

The hands and hearts of hundreds of volunteers make it possible for hundreds of thousands to remember their loved ones at the Lantern Floating Hawaii ceremony.

Volunteers prepare, light, collect and clean each lantern. Lantern preparation begins in March and lantern cleanup concludes in July.
